I was installing a new trigger in my EAA/Tanfoglio Witness Hunter 10mm, and I found it IMPOSSIBLE to hold the trigger spring in place until I could drive in the roll pin. I found a brass tool for the job sold online, but it was out of stock everywhere in the US, and $40 to boot. So my 3D printer came to the rescue. It took about 15 minutes to print (at 100% infill) and made the job possible (if still not-quite-easy).
If anyone finds themselves struggling to install a trigger in their CZ75 or a clone thereof, the file is free to download at Thingiverse.
